Johnny Murphy has got us invited to display our Minis in the Mallow St. Patrick's Day Parade on March 17th.

Mallow is the point where the N20 Cork-Limerick road meets the N72 Dungarvan-Killarney road so it should suit most of our Southern Region members though everyone is invited along with their 1959-2000 Mini.

Entry to the parade is free and we'll assemble at the Toyota garage on the Limerick side of Mallow no later than 12.30.
